Is it safe to even start puppy socialization walks in this heat??

Daisy's only 4 months and I really want to start getting her out and meeting people/dogs before her fear period hits but I'm so nervous about the heat messing with her since she's still so little. Do puppies overheat faster than adult dogs?? Should I just be doing all socialization indoors right now?? Sorry for all the questions I just really don't want to mess this up šŸ˜…

Yes, puppies overheat faster, less developed thermoregulation. Solution:

early morning or evening only

keep sessions short, 15-20 min

indoor puppy classes/pet stores work great too
